kqcircuits.masks
- kqcircuits.masks.mask_export
- kqcircuits.masks.mask_layout
MaskLayoutMaskLayout.layoutMaskLayout.nameMaskLayout.versionMaskLayout.with_gridMaskLayout.face_idMaskLayout.layers_to_maskMaskLayout.covered_region_excluded_layersMaskLayout.chips_mapMaskLayout.align_toMaskLayout.chips_map_legendMaskLayout.wafer_radMaskLayout.wafer_centerMaskLayout.chips_map_offsetMaskLayout.wafer_top_flat_lengthMaskLayout.wafer_bottom_flat_lengthMaskLayout.dice_widthMaskLayout.text_marginMaskLayout.chip_sizeMaskLayout.edge_clearanceMaskLayout.remove_chipsMaskLayout.chip_box_offsetMaskLayout.chip_transMaskLayout.mask_name_offsetMaskLayout.mask_name_scaleMaskLayout.mask_name_box_marginMaskLayout.mask_text_scaleMaskLayout.mask_markers_dictMaskLayout.mask_marker_offsetMaskLayout.mask_export_layersMaskLayout.mask_export_density_layersMaskLayout.submasksMaskLayout.extra_idMaskLayout.extra_chipsMaskLayout.top_cellMaskLayout.added_chipsMaskLayout.chips_placed_by_position_labelMaskLayout.chip_copiesMaskLayout.mirror_labelsMaskLayout.bbox_face_idsMaskLayout.add_chips_map()MaskLayout.build()MaskLayout.insert_chips()MaskLayout.generate_position_label()MaskLayout.generate_and_insert_chip_copy_labels()MaskLayout.insert_chip_copy_labels()MaskLayout.face()MaskLayout.two_coordinates_to_position_label()MaskLayout.position_label_to_two_coordinates()
- kqcircuits.masks.mask_set
MaskSetMaskSet.viewMaskSet.layoutMaskSet.nameMaskSet.versionMaskSet.with_gridMaskSet.export_drcMaskSet.chips_map_legendMaskSet.mask_layoutsMaskSet.mask_export_layersMaskSet.used_chipsMaskSet.export_pathMaskSet.add_mask_layout()MaskSet.add_multi_face_mask_layout()MaskSet.add_chip()MaskSet.build()MaskSet.export()MaskSet.chips_map_from_box_map()
- kqcircuits.masks.multi_face_mask_layout
Module contents
Modules for generating and exporting masks.
Masks are represented by mask sets, which can contain one or more mask layouts. Each mask layout consists of a chip layout and a list of chip variants.
The following things can be exported for the mask and the chips:
layout files with specific layers
images with specific layers
automatic documentation containing:
number of each chip in the mask
chip parameters
images of the mask layout and chips